Summary

The Master Slider – Responsive Touch Slider plugin for WordPress has a vulnerability that allows authenticated attackers with contributor-level access or higher to exploit the plugin's ms_layer shortcode. This occurs due to insufficient input sanitization and output escaping on user-supplied attributes. Attackers can inject arbitrary web scripts, which execute when users visit affected pages, leading to potential data theft or site compromise.

Affected Version(s)

Master Slider – Responsive Touch Slider * <= 3.10.6
